Best mountain in utah

what is the best mountain in utah because i have to choose where to go for my dads birthday and i dont no what mountainis the best in terms of powder and best snow.
 
for epic powder its alta, for no lift lines and almost as good powder its solitude, for ok powder and a bit of park its snowbird, for just park its park city
